Hello

Been selling on ebay for a few years now. Never had a problem. Just sold a expensive piece of currency for $950 best offer. Didn't get a offer, buyer elected to pay $950 straight out.

Buyer has zero feedback. Female name. Looked at the address its a house three times the size of mine. User name is kinda odd though. For example it looked something like this. JH?!!fiopLL@

I plan on fully insuring it

What do you think? Should I be concerned? What defensive measures can I take?

that user name means they have signed in as a guest, and that would be why no feedback. not unusal at all. alot of people are chosing to by items this way instead of signing up.. but yes insured , with tracking and a signature..

Selling online is never 100% safe but you can do things to help minimize the risk.

Signature Delivery Confirmation and following ebay and PayPal's best practices for Seller's and you should be good to go.

I know that Paypal requires signature confirmation, not just delivery confirmation if the value is over 250.00.
